Hi everyone,

I have PDF Generator running fine and I can convert different formats to pdf.

Now I want to setup launchpad for my users to use PDFG. LC Server is using SSL.

LaunchPad can interact with the service and get all the icons (Create pdf, Export pdf.. etc) but when I try to active the 'Create PDF' to import a file i put in the interface I get an error dialogue with the following error:

DSC Invocation Resulted in Error: class com.adobe.idp.DocumentError : javax.net.ssl.SSLHandshakeException: sun.security.validator.ValidatorException: PKIX path building failed: sun.security.provider.certpath.SunCertPathBuilderException: unable to find valid certification path to requested target : javax.net.ssl.SSLHandshakeException: sun.security.validator.ValidatorException: PKIX path building failed: sun.security.provider.certpath.SunCertPathBuilderException: unable to find valid certification path to requested target

Can anyone instruct me on how to set up these certificates in JBoss or where it needs to be set up to make LaunchPad work.
